Vita
She graduated from the Faculty of Medicine of the Tomsk Medical Institute (1996) with a degree in General Medicine, and completed residency training with a degree in Psychiatry (1996-1998) at the Mental Health Research Institute of the Siberian Branch of the Russian Academy of Medical Sciences (currently the Mental Health Research Institute of the Tomsk NRMC, Tomsk).
In 2001, she defended her thesis for the degree of Candidate of Medical Sciences: “Clinical-constitutional features and adaptive capabilities of patients with simple schizophrenia” (scientific adviser, doctor of medical sciences, professor A.V. Semke), and in 2016 - the thesis for the degree of Doctor of Medical Sciences: "Schizophrenia with a predominance of negative disorders: clinical-constitutional patterns, adaptation, therapy."
Since 1998, she has been a Junior Researcher, since 2000 a Researcher, subsequently a Senior Researcher, and since 2016, a Lead Researcher at the Department of Endogenous Disorders.
Area of scientific and clinical interests
Schizophrenia, constitution, psychopharmacotherapy, rehabilitation, adjustment
Total number of publications is more than 140, of them 12 – in foreign press.
She develops an anthropological direction in psychiatry, has repeatedly participated as a rater and researcher in multicenter clinical trials of psychotropic drugs, has been trained at international trainings, is also a highly qualified doctor, provides advisory psychiatric and psychotherapeutic help in somatic medicine - clinics of the Siberian Medical University and consultative-diagnostic Center "Professor".
